bf received the solasfera today. I haven't seen it yet, but will be in a couple days. I have a general question about fire. BF viewed the stone at home and he said when he was looking at the stone close (2 ft), there isn't much fire. When he looked at the stone 5 ft away the stone just lit up. Why do we see less fire close and tons of fire far away? Is it the same with H&A? I don't remember anything about H&A behaving like that when I was at the jewelry store.

Part of the answer is in the nature of fire and the way that the physics of light works and the way that our eyes perceive color in light. When we receive the entire spectrum of light in a ray of light we perceive that light as white (actually colorless). When light is bent coming out of an optically dense media it shows its colors, think of the prisms that we played with as children, breaking a ray of light into rainbows on the wall. Dispersion in a diamond is like that, but MUCH smaller. If the ray of light that is bent is narrower than the iris of the eye at the point at which it is seen by the eye, then the light will appear as a colorless sparkle. If the ray is wider than the iris of the eye, it will appear as a colored event, or disperion. The solisfera has ten arrows and more facets than a standard round brilliant cut diamoind. Thus both the facets and the virtual facets are much smaller than those from a standard round brilliant and will appear to have a lot more colorless events than the round when viewed close up. From several feet away the rays have had the time to expand to a width that is larger than the iris of the eye and thus you will receive the full benefit of the many thousands of extra virtual facets that the solisfera has. But this seems to contradict what Wink just said. The virtual facets of a RB vary in size from med. to small. The virtual facets of an oec range from large to small. The med sized virtual facet on a 1.6ish oec is larger than the largest virtual facet on a .5ct RB. An oec typically draws light from different locations than a RB (more and different locations of green in an ASET image) The oec will have more separation between the flashes because of the larger virtual facets and likely isn't as directional. Small flashes from small virtual facets with little separation tend to combine and be seen as white light. In dispersion, the color you are seeing is the part of the ray of light that is bent into the spectral colors, like going through a prism. In fact if you have a steady hand sometimes you can slowly move a diamond and watch the dispersion change from one color to another. In the paper experiment that you refer to above the light is no longer white light, since it is coming off the colored paper which has absorbed some of the spectrum leaving our eyes perceiving the resultant color as red. Thus the color that we see is no longer dependant on the ray of light at our iris being wider than our iris to avoid it being perceived of as white light. It stands to reason that white light broken into its spectral colors may be more visibly colored at a greater distance than close up to where the break-up is occurring. The white light is spreading apart as its colors become visible since each color moves are a slightly differing speed through air (or any other medium). As you step back from the prismatic effect, the distance increases in the spread of the spectral display. More colors could be easily seen at a distance than close up.
